But now let’s get into the technician and see how to pair Alexa and the LED lights.

The first step you need to take is to download the official smart bulb app (or socket and switch). In this case it depends on the brand you have chosen and the manufacturer ( Philips Hue , Osram , TP-Link Kasa , Ikea , Lifx , Yeelight , Amazon , Bticino, etc. ). As you can imagine, the more famous the company will be, the more chances you will have of having an updated and functional application.

Downloaded and installed take care that you have already opened the light box and proceed to start the application. At this point the program will show you each step to follow to make the connection between the devices, it is usually identical in all products of this type. The app will ask you to register on their official website by entering your e-mail address , password , and then to select the Wi-Fi connection in your home .

When you have chosen the connection it will ask you to select the environment in which the lights are installed and will lead you to the end of the procedure.

Now the biggest job has been done, you just have to download Amazon Alexa on your smartphone. Access the Store of your Android or iOS operating system and after downloading and installing it you can start it. By opening the application you can make the connection by pressing on Devices , in the menu at the bottom, and tapping on (+) , located at the top right, choose Add device .

Here you will see the compatible and available devices, including your LED lights. Select Lamp and then the brand of the device and tap the Next button to connect the lamp to Alexa and go to the skill store, activate the manufacturer skill and detect your devices. Finally tap on Enable for use .

Make sure you have Wi-Fi active on the same frequency (2.4 GHz or 5 GHz).

Now just tell Alexa where the device is: Office, Bedroom, Living Room, Office, etc. and once configured, start controlling it by issuing commands that you find in the chapter How to control the LEDs with Alexa .

How to connect led strip to Alexa

But there are not only LED lights, but also many other types of lighting. Among these the most purchased are certainly the led strips , but how to connect them to the Alexa voice assistant? Let’s see how to do it.

In order for you to connect these two systems you need to have a smart controller . Through the connectivity between the LED strip and the smart controller you can subsequently manage everything from the lights app, having a real control hub. There are different types of smart controllers, but the connection process is similar in all products. Let’s see what you need to do to connect Alexa to the led strip .

Install the led strip to the smart controller and then the latter to the electrical outlet. At this point, download the official app of the company that produced the controller on your smartphone. Create the profile if you do not already have one and pressing, at the top right, on (+) select All devices . Now you just have to choose the item Lighting devices and configure the led strips as seen previously.

Be careful to connect, in the Alexa app, the smart controller and not the led strip. In case you have difficulty finding it, the advice is to start Alexa , tap on Devices , at the bottom right, and tap the (+) button , at the top, and then Add device . Choose the item Other and tap the Find devices button and wait for the Amazon Alexa app to find the device.

How to connect Led Gosund to Alexa

You will surely have heard of the famous Gosund led strips for their excellent connectivity with smart objects, let’s see in short how to connect them to your favorite voice assistant.

Download the Gosund app from the App Store or Play Store depending on your operating system. Open the application, register and login. Search for devices of this brand nearby and connect them to the application, you can also rename them to your liking so as not to get confused with other software.

Now download the Alexa app and inside it look for the Gosund company in the Alexa Skills section . Activate the Gosund skill option and add your registration data on the Gosund platform. Now just say it out loud. “ Alexa, discover devices ” and the voice assistant will highlight the found ones.

At the end you can start by saying:

  • Alexa, turn on the living room light.
  • Alexa, turn off the living room light.
  • Alexa, dim the living room light.

How to connect Tapo bulb to Alexa

Make sure that you have connected the Tapo devices to the electricity supply and that you have set up the same Wi-Fi network. At this point, start the Amazon Alexa application and press on the Other option that you find in the bottom menu. Now select the item Skills and Games . Press on the magnifying glass and write the word Tapo, stop on Enable and access the connected Tapo devices with your router. Give permission to connect and you will have Alexa connected in seconds.

How to connect Lifx bulb to Alexa

Download and install the LIFX application from the Store of your operating system, you will find the software completely free do not worry, you will only have to register with an email and a username.

Now launch the Alexa application and look in the Devices> (+)> Add Device> Lamp section for LIFX . Once you have identified plug it above, press the Next button and Enable LIFX Optimized for Smart Home use by connecting an account and following the instructions.

Again, if you have more lights than the Lifx, equip yourself with a smart controller to avoid problems.

At the end you can start by saying:

  • Alexa, put the kitchen on seventy percent.
  • Alexa, set the lights to warm white.
  • Alexa, lower the bedroom by twenty-five percent.

How to connect smart life bulb to Alexa

Maybe you are a supporter of the Smart Life line and you can’t help but connect Alexa to your home’s lighting system, how to do it?

Launch the Play Store or App Store and download the official application called Smart Life . Proceed with the installation and register a new account or log in with the existing one. Now plug in your smart products and insert them into the devices visible from Smart Life.

At this point, download or open the Alexa app and look for the Smart Life item in the Alexa Skills section. Activate this feature and proceed to finish the configuration by searching for nearby devices.

How to control the LEDs with Alexa

The next step in connecting Alexa and led lights is to control the lights themselves. Fortunately it is more difficult said than done, let’s see how to do it.

Once you have finished configuring the lights, sockets or switches, you can start controlling the lights through Alexa. You can do this with the Amazon Echo by shouting out loud the phrase “ Alexa, turn on the lights (adding the name you named them with) “.

Alternative to Amazon Echo is the Amazon Alexa application on mobile device. Take care to activate the voice assistant and after checking that you are on the same Wi-Fi network exclaim the above phrase to turn on the lights.

Here are other commands you can use:

  • Alexa, turn lights on / off [light name or room name].
  • Alexa, set the light to 50%.
  • Alexa, turn the light up / down.
  • Alexa, turn the light in [room name] green.
  • Alexa, set the [room name] light to red.
  • Alexa, make [room name] light warmer.

Create and control light groups

With Alexa you can also set up light groups. To create you need to launch the Alexa app and tap the Devices icon at the bottom. Then click on the (+) button , at the top, and then on Add group .

Here you can Create a room or a group of devices or Combine rooms or groups . By pressing on Create a room , for example, all you have to do is give the room a name and add the devices by selecting them. The latter must already be connected and therefore visible in the list.

How to program lights on with Alexa

Maybe you are a perfectionist and want the lights to turn on precisely when you want them. Make sure the lights are connected to both electricity and Wi-Fi, then launch the Amazon Alexa app .

Click on the Other option and then on the Routine item . Now press the (+) button at the top right and choose the option Enter the name of the routine .

Give the event a name and click Next . Select the item When this happens and then Schedule .

Here you can choose the time of day to start the lights automatically.

After setting the day and time, go to Add an action> Custom and type what you want to ask Alexa. For example ” Alexa turn off all lights “.

Click on Next , at the top right, and then on Save to complete everything.
